深入解析对象存储应用权限,安全与效率的平衡之道
- 综合资讯
- 2024-12-17 20:21:39
- 2

深入探讨对象存储在权限管理、安全保障与性能效率之间的平衡艺术,分析如何确保数据安全的前提下,实现高效便捷的对象存储服务。...
深入探讨对象存储在权限管理、安全保障与性能效率之间的平衡艺术,分析如何确保数据安全的前提下,实现高效便捷的对象存储服务。
随着互联网技术的飞速发展,对象存储已经成为大数据、云计算等领域的核心技术之一,对象存储以其高效、可靠、可扩展等优势,被广泛应用于各个行业,在享受对象存储带来的便利的同时,如何确保应用权限的安全性成为亟待解决的问题,本文将深入解析对象存储应用权限,探讨安全与效率的平衡之道。
对象存储应用权限概述
1、对象存储简介
对象存储是一种基于文件的存储方式,将数据存储为一个个对象,每个对象包含数据本身以及相关的元数据信息,对象存储系统由存储节点、元数据服务、访问控制、数据备份等功能模块组成。
2、应用权限概述
应用权限是指用户在对象存储系统中对数据进行访问、操作等行为的权限限制,权限管理是保证数据安全的重要手段,主要包括以下内容:
(1)访问控制:根据用户身份和角色,限制用户对数据的访问权限。
(2)数据加密:对存储在对象存储中的数据进行加密,防止数据泄露。
(3)审计日志:记录用户对数据的访问和操作行为,便于追踪和审计。
对象存储应用权限的安全性分析
1、用户身份认证
用户身份认证是保证对象存储应用权限安全的基础,常见的认证方式包括:
(1)用户名/密码:用户通过输入用户名和密码进行认证。
(2)OAuth2.0:授权第三方应用访问用户数据。
(3)JWT(JSON Web Token):通过生成令牌实现用户认证。
2、访问控制
访问控制是对象存储应用权限的核心,主要包括以下策略:
(1)基于角色的访问控制(RBAC):根据用户角色分配访问权限,简化权限管理。
(2)基于属性的访问控制(ABAC):根据用户属性(如部门、职位等)分配访问权限。
(3)最小权限原则:用户只能访问其工作所需的最低权限数据。
3、数据加密
数据加密是保证数据安全的重要手段,常见的加密方式包括:
(1)对称加密:使用相同的密钥进行加密和解密。
(2)非对称加密:使用公钥和私钥进行加密和解密。
(3)混合加密:结合对称加密和非对称加密的优势。
4、审计日志
审计日志记录用户对数据的访问和操作行为,便于追踪和审计,审计日志应包含以下信息:
(1)用户名、IP地址、访问时间。
(2)操作类型(如读取、写入、删除等)。
(3)数据对象标识。
对象存储应用权限的效率优化
1、缓存策略
为了提高访问效率,可以采用缓存策略,将热点数据缓存到内存中,常见的缓存策略包括:
(1)LRU(最近最少使用)缓存。
(2)LRU2(最近最少访问)缓存。
(3)缓存淘汰算法。
2、异步处理
异步处理可以将数据访问和操作过程分解为多个环节,提高系统并发处理能力,常见的异步处理方式包括:
(1)消息队列:将数据访问和操作请求放入消息队列,由后台服务进行处理。
(2)事件驱动:根据事件触发数据访问和操作。
3、分布式存储
分布式存储可以提高数据存储的可靠性和可扩展性,降低单点故障风险,常见的分布式存储架构包括:
(1)分布式文件系统:如HDFS、Ceph等。
(2)分布式对象存储:如Amazon S3、OpenStack Swift等。
对象存储应用权限的安全与效率是相辅相成的,在实际应用中,应根据业务需求和安全要求,合理配置应用权限,确保数据安全,通过优化缓存策略、异步处理和分布式存储等技术,提高系统效率,实现安全与效率的平衡。
本文链接:https://zhitaoyun.cn/1629619.html
发表评论